Blood gases is a test done to measure how much oxygen and carbon dioxide is in your blood. It also looks at the acidity (pH) of the blood. Usually, blood gases look at blood from an artery. In rarer cases, blood from a vein may be used.

Blood gases are defined as the mixture of gases, including oxygen (O 2 ), carbon dioxide (CO 2 ), and nitrogen (N 2 ), dissolved in the fluid fraction of blood. Oxygen from the air is transported from the lungs to all tissues of the body, where it is needed for metabolism ; and carbon dioxide, a by-product of metabolism, is taken from the tissues to the lungs to be eliminated.

Blood gas analysis, also called arterial blood gas (ABG) analysis, is a procedure to measure the partial pressure of oxygen (O 2 ) and carbon dioxide (CO 2 ) gases and the pH (hydrogen ion concentration) in arterial blood. Purpose Blood gas analysis is used to diagnose and evaluate respiratory diseases and conditions that influence how effectively the lungs deliver oxygen to and eliminate carbon dioxide from the blood.

Urine typically contains epithelial cells shed from the urinary tract. Urine cytology evaluates this urinary sediment for the presence of cancerous cells from the lining of the urinary tract, and it is a convenient noninvasive technique for follow-up analysis of patients treated for urinary tract cancers.

A urine dipstick is a colorimetric chemical assay that can be used to determine the pH, specific gravity, protein, glucose, ketone, bilirubin, urobilinogen, blood, leukocyte, and nitrite levels of an individual ' s urine. It consists of a reagent stick-pad, which is immersed in a fresh urine specimen and then withdrawn.

X-rays are a form of electromagnetic radiation, just like visible light. In a health care setting, a machines sends are individual x-ray particles, called photons. These particles pass through the body. A computer or special film is used to record the images that are created. Structures that are dense (such as bone) will block most of the x-ray particles, and will appear white. Metal and contrast media (special dye used to highlight areas of the body) will also appear white. Structures containing air will be black and muscle, fat, and fluid will appear as shades of gray.
